Summary

Welcome to Insectarium Junior, created in collaboration with the Royal Entomological Society.

This museum is open all hours, and there are hundreds of specimens to explore. Walk the galleries to meet shimmering butterflies, jewel-like beetles, glowing fireflies, and enormous stick insects in this beautifully illustrated guide to the insects that inhabit almost every corner of the globe. About The Author

Dave Goulson

Dave Goulson is Professor of Biology at the University of Sussex, specializing in bee ecology. He has published over 300 scientific articles on the ecology and conservation of bumblebees and other insects. He is the author of the Sunday Times bestseller A Sting in the Tale, which has been translated into seventeen languages. This was followed by A Buzz in the Meadow (2014), Bee Quest (2017), The Garden Jungle and Gardening for Bumblebees (2019), and Silent Earth (2021).

Emily Carter is an award-winning British designer based in London, specializing in hand-illustrated silk accessories, stationery, and furnishings. Her collections incorporate themes from natural history, flora, fauna, and scientific illustration to create surreal and unique illustrations and prints.

The Royal Entomological Society is devoted to the understanding and development of insect science. The RES supports international collaboration, research, and publication. They aim to show every person how remarkable and valuable insects are and want to enrich the world with insect science.
